Takiron Co., Ltd. (President: Yuushi Fukuda, hereinafter "Takiron Co., Ltd."), a comprehensive resin processing manufacturer, is pleased to announce that its group company, Dipla Wintes Co., Ltd. (hereinafter "Dipla Wintes"), held an anniversary ceremony to commemorate its 30th anniversary.

Dipla Wintes, as the world's only specialized manufacturer of evaluation equipment such as SAICAS (surface/interface property analysis system) and Metal Weather (super accelerated weathering tester), contributes to research and development and technological innovation in cutting-edge fields such as automotive, construction, energy, and semiconductors.

■ Business Activities

World's Only!SAICAS "Surface/Interface Property Analysis System"

Overview

≪Precisely cuts the "surface to interface" of materials extremely thinly≫

An evaluation testing device that measures the peel strength and shear strength of adherends by interlocking the cutting edge horizontally and vertically for micro-drive control and stress measurement.
